* fig-press--: The FIG Disciplinary Commission suspended Acrobatic Gymnastics Category I Judge Mr. Joao Carvalho (POR) for one year for grave faults in his function as Chair of Judges Panel occurred during the 2014 FIG Acro World Cup held in Maia, Portugal, between March 7 and 9, 2014. The judge was found guilty to have intentionally or with gross negligence overseen two grave errors of his compatriots, thus showing twice a very significant bias behaviour in favour of his competitors. The 2014 Acrobatic Gymnastics World Championships, along with the World Age Group Competitions, will be held at the Palais des Sports Marcel Cerdan of Levallois (FRA), in the north-western outskirts of Paris. More than 600 gymnasts total are expected to participate in the World Age Group Competitions, set for July 2 – 5, and the World Championships, scheduled for July 10-12.
